How do I choose a group?
Some people are looking for fellowship and need an ongoing group that meets every week with no scheduled end date. Others are looking for biblical answers to specific questions or issues. They want a group that meets for a specific number of weeks about a singular subject or topic. You decide the kind of group that suits you best right now. You are under no obligation to stay in a group. So, give one a try. If it doesn’t work for you, try something else.  With plenty of options, there is sure to be a group for you.
